A New Perspective on Food Allergies
The study, published in JAMA Pediatrics, analyzed data from 7,200 infants aged 11-15 months across two population samples. One group was from 2007-11, before the 2016 guideline update, and the other was from 2018-19, after the update. The results were striking: egg allergy prevalence decreased from 9.2% to 7.6% after the guidelines were revised.
What makes this study particularly fascinating is the focus on hard data. Unlike many previous studies that relied on parents’ reports, this one used skin prick tests and food challenges to confirm allergies. This rigorous approach provides a more reliable picture of the impact of the guidelines.
The Impact of Dietary Guidelines
The Australasian Society of Clinical Immunology and Allergy (ASCIA) updated its guidelines in 2016 to recommend introducing common food allergens, including eggs, into a child’s diet in the first year of life. This shift marked a significant departure from previous advice, which often delayed the introduction of these allergens until 1-3 years of age, especially for children with a family history of allergies.

The Role of Healthcare Providers
Dr. Nick Cooling, Chair of RACGP Specific Interests Allergy, emphasizes the importance of healthcare providers understanding these new guidelines. According to him, the updated recommendations are even more extreme, suggesting that eggs should be introduced as soon as a baby is ready for solids, typically around six months of age. This is a significant change from the advice given just a decade ago.

Broader Implications and Future Directions
The study’s findings on egg allergies could have broader implications for other common food allergens, such as cow’s milk, peanut, tree nuts, soy, wheat, fish, and shellfish. Dr. Cooling believes that the same trends observed with eggs could apply to these other allergens, and he’s right to be curious. But it’s important to note that each allergen has its own unique characteristics and risks, so further research is needed to fully understand the impact of early introduction for each.
